LetterMeLater is a free web service that lets you schedule your Emails for future. You simply need to create an account, and start composing mails from your primary Email id, for the future. You can schedule mail with best wishes or meetings prior to the date! And there are many such events that you don’t want to miss in any case.

This is a very useful service for those who do not have much time to come online, or have the ability to forget things on time, like me! icon razz Schedule your Emails for Future with LetterMeLater With a simple interface, one gets a list of useful features -

  • Use any of your email addresses to send mails.
  • Send email to any number of contacts or import contact list and create mailing list.
  • Create text-rich HTML Emails.
  • Ability to schedule Emails to any time, date, or month, and edit it before it is sent!
  • No Advertisements in emails.
  • Schedule emails with your own email program!
  • Send text messages to your cell phone.
